index.js 1.1 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152
  1. import {
  2. DebugTilesRenderer,
  3. NONE,
  4. SCREEN_ERROR,
  5. GEOMETRIC_ERROR,
  6. DISTANCE,
  7. DEPTH,
  8. RELATIVE_DEPTH,
  9. IS_LEAF,
  10. RANDOM_COLOR,
  11. } from './three/DebugTilesRenderer.js';
  12. import { TilesRenderer } from './three/TilesRenderer.js';
  13. import { B3DMLoader } from './three/B3DMLoader.js';
  14. import { PNTSLoader } from './three/PNTSLoader.js';
  15. import { I3DMLoader } from './three/I3DMLoader.js';
  16. import { CMPTLoader } from './three/CMPTLoader.js';
  17. import { TilesRendererBase } from './base/TilesRendererBase.js';
  18. import { B3DMLoaderBase } from './base/B3DMLoaderBase.js';
  19. import { I3DMLoaderBase } from './base/I3DMLoaderBase.js';
  20. import { PNTSLoaderBase } from './base/PNTSLoaderBase.js';
  21. import { CMPTLoaderBase } from './base/CMPTLoaderBase.js';
  22. import { LRUCache } from './utilities/LRUCache.js';
  23. import { PriorityQueue } from './utilities/PriorityQueue.js';
  24. export {
  25. DebugTilesRenderer,
  26. TilesRenderer,
  27. B3DMLoader,
  28. PNTSLoader,
  29. I3DMLoader,
  30. CMPTLoader,
  31. TilesRendererBase,
  32. B3DMLoaderBase,
  33. I3DMLoaderBase,
  34. PNTSLoaderBase,
  35. CMPTLoaderBase,
  36. LRUCache,
  37. PriorityQueue,
  38. NONE,
  39. SCREEN_ERROR,
  40. GEOMETRIC_ERROR,
  41. DISTANCE,
  42. DEPTH,
  43. RELATIVE_DEPTH,
  44. IS_LEAF,
  45. RANDOM_COLOR,
  46. };